DRAKE POSTPONES APOLLO THEATHER CONCERT OUT OF RESPECT FOR TAKEOFF: Drake has potponed his Friday (November 11th) concert at the Apollo Theather due to Takeoff's funeral, which will be held at the State Farm Arena. According to Complex, the rapper announced that the new date for the Apollo Theater will be on December 6th and 7th.

KANYE WEST SUED FOR BDP SAMPLE: According to TMZ, Kanye West is being sued over his “Life Of The Party” song for using a sample of Boogie Down Productions' hit “South Bronx.” According to legal docs, the record company that owns the copyright to the song claims that Ye never got permission to sample the song when her released it as a bonus track on Donda on the Stem player device. The company said that Ye and his partner Alex Klein sold around 11K Stem Players within the first 24 hours of its release, making around $2.2 million dollars, but claims they never got permission to use the sample even though the company says Ye’s team initially reached out to try to license it. The company says they never came to an agreement and says that Ye's side eventually retracted its offer to license it. The company is now looking to block further use of the song in the track and wants Ye to hand over any profits generated off it.

KODAK BLACK AND DESIIGNER RESPOND TO 21 SAVAGE SAYING HE COULD BEAT ANYONE FROM 2016 FRESHMAN LIST IN A VERZUZ: 21 Savage recently said that he felt that no one from the XXL Freshman class of 2016 could beat him in a Verzuz battle. He explained, “No one from that… Freshman cover beat me in no Verzuz.” 21 was featured alongside Lil Uzi Vert, Lil Yachty, Kodak Black, Denzel Curry, G Herbo, Dave East, Lil Dicky, Desiigner, and Anderson .Paak. In a response shared during a recent Instagram Live stream, Kodak Black said that he admires 21 Savage’s confidence but called his suggestion “cap.” He continued, “That’s how you should feel, know what I mean? But you know I always put myself first over any n***a, any day. That’s cap.” Desiigner also responded, saying, “Ay man, why you talking like that? You’re 21. I went platinum 20 times. … Stop playing.”

DABABY HAS A BOGO OFFER FOR AN UPCOMING SHOW: DaBaby was trending on social media yesterday (November 7th) after it was revealed that the rapper has a show in Birmingham, AL and the tickets has a BOGO offer: if you buy the tickets at $22, you will be able to get a second ticket for free. Social media reacted immediately, with one person saying, “DaBaby selling his tickets BOGO has got to be the saddest sh*t ever for a rapper. And it’s crazy cause nobody else hurt his career more than he did. Talk about self-sabotage, a lack of situational awareness, and ego.” The concert is set to take place on November 15th.
